PC Manager app for Windows 11

PC Manager app is a PC optimization tool for Windows OS i.e Windows 11 or maybe Windows 10 as well using which you can clean temporary files, manage startup apps, monitor resource usage, and view suggestion offered by Microsoft. For example, set Edge as the default browser and Bing as the default search engine. Some of the features that are available in the PC manager app in beta are as follow:

Clean files, and remove apps with a single clickEnable-Disable startup apps with a single click that will help in improving startup time and boot performance.Check and view processes running in the background and take action using Task Manager.Virus check powered by Microsoft Security or Microsoft Defender app.Check for the latest update available.

In short, the application is home to various shortcuts to manage multiple settings or features that already exist in Windows 11. All the information shared above is based on the information available on the leaked screenshot of the PC Manager (Beta) app. There’s no official information available on when Microsoft will release it to the general public.
